Pengertian save point
Savepoint adalah batu
loncatan untuk transaksi dimana kondisi database dapat dikembalikan keposisi
saat savepoint dibuat. Semua perubahan yang melewati savepoint tersebut akan
dibuatpermanen.
Pengertian Commit
Adalah perintah yang berfungsi
untuk mengendalikan pengeksekusian transaksi yang menyetujui rangkaian perintah
yang berhubungan erat dengan perintah yang sebelumnya telah
berhasil dilakukan.
Pengertian Rollback
Adalah perintah yang berfungsi untuk mengendalikan pengeksekusian transaksi yang membatalkan transaksi yang dilakukan karena adanya kesalahan atau kegagalan pada salah satu rangkaian perintah
Contoh program
save point
insert into
produk
values('P0006','Permen','S0001','K3','1000','20','0'),
('P0007','Bayam','S0001','K2','1000','30','0');
ROLLBACK TO
SAVEPOINT sp1;
COMMIT;
Contoh program commit dan rollback
Commit
INSERT INTO departments
VALUES (290, ‘Corporate Tax’,
NULL, 1700);
COMMIT;
Rollback
DELETE FROM copy_emp;
ROLLBACK;
Tidak ada komentar:
Posting Komentar